At the end of 2011 your Practice undertook a survey both at the Practice and via posting out questionnaires to seek the views and thoughts of a representative group of our Patients.
The full detailed results of this survey are now available on the Patient Participation Group page. The headline to this survey was that 86% of our Patients rated the Practice as Good, Very good or Excellent. Of course there were areas where we could improve and we met with our Patient Group in February to discuss key areas to work with them to further improve the Practice.
The two key areas they asked us to focus on throughout 2012 were the speed in which we answered calls, particularly first thing in the morning and the length of time you as a Patient have to wait when at the Surgery. We have been rearranging our appointment system to offer two types of doctor appointment - here is an update...
Appointments can be booked up to 4 weeks in advance. Same day urgent appointments are made available at 8.30 am by phone on 01785 815555.
Whenever you contact the surgery by phone or in person at the desk we will ask you whether you need a routine book ahead appointment or a same day urgent appointment.
Routine book ahead service (also available for internet booking)
You will be offered the next available routine appointment with any doctor or you may book to see a specific doctor if you prefer to wait longer for his/her availability.
Please use this service if you wish to discuss routine issues or wish to see a specific doctor.
We no longer offer same day availability for routine matters.
Same day urgent care service
About a third of our appointments are used for this same day booking service for urgent care only.
It is split between a few doctors on the day so we can rarely offer Dr choice in this urgent situation.
We will ensure that all urgent problems are seen as soon as possible on the day they arise.
Please don't block others urgent need for this service by booking same day for routine matters.
Some useful tips:
Book ahead if you wish to see a specific doctor as we cannot accommodate you on the day.
Unless urgent, avoid calling between 8:30-9:30am as this is our busiest time and you will be able to get through quicker to book a routine appointment at other times.
Please contact us as soon as you are aware that you have an urgent problem so that we can see you that day.
Please arrive a little before your booked time. A late arriving patient will delay the remainder of the surgery for all remaining patients - for this reason we ask patients arriving more than a few minutes late to rebook for another time.
However, please note that all of our Practice Nurse appointments should be booked in advance by phone or in person, so that we can allocate sufficient time for each procedure. We regret that at the moment Practice Nurse appointments cannot be booked via the internet.
If you are late for an appointment, you may be asked to re-book or wait until the end of surgery to be seen. The doctors try to keep to time but this is not always possible due to the complexity of some conditions. We would request your patience in such circumstances.

If you have an urgent dental problem such as toothache or a dental abscess you should see a dentist not your GP.
If you have a regular dentist you should telephone them and arrange an urgent appointment. If they are closed there should be an answer phone message with the phone number of the local dentist covering emergencies. If you have trouble getting through call NHS Direct on 0845 46 47.
